On December 20, 2021, the Italian regulator Consob issued a warning against a total of 15 websites that offer illegal financial services or are scams. In contrast to the last weeks, Consob did not announce a blackout of the websites. Among those warned is also the offshore broker Moneta Markets and its operator Vantage Global Limited. In addition, the Italian regulator has also warned about several fraudulent Bitcoin marketing campaigns. Below is the list of the latest warnings:
The fraudulent Bitcoin Era campaign promotes the JavaMarkets broker scam operated from the Marshall Islands. On the website, we did not find any information about the legal entity or individuals behind the scam. Anyone who registers with the Bitcoin Era campaign on the Secured Offers website is also automatically created as a victim at JavaMarkets and taken to its payment page. We click on the link sent along and land on the Bitcoin Era scam campaign running on the DigitalInvest Era website. By registering with Bitcoin Era, one is automatically registered as a customer with the broker scam Swise Invest and redirected to the scam's payment page. Allegedly, the scam is operated by Luten X LLC on St. Vincent and the Grenadines.
The fraudulent affiliate cam is conducted in multiple languages, even for smaller language areas like Slovenian. Once registered with one of the many fraudulent affiliate schemes, our research team is served with literally dozens of new scams every day via email, phone, or social media. Currently, cryptocurrencies are used to lure client-victims. These emails introduce crypto investment opportunities. In fact, you are redirected to scams via websites like Bitcoin Billionaire, Bitcoin Revolution, or Bitcoin Era. But also CySEC-registered CIFs use this fraud service. Yesterday and today, we found Trade360, which use it to get customers to deposit without KYC/AML and false promises.
